Transaction b8489f7b754548331b95dee8ac4b23471da24ab9c70847167fcd4685fbb07bc6
1 Input
1 Output
-
b8489f7b754548331b95dee8ac4b23471da24ab9c70847167fcd4685fbb07bc6:0
- value
- 1383604
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b43c66714c77508c37a7df53339fbd12d4f015f OP_EQUAL
- address
- 3JmBUWKWqD3hwDhQfXMYHd76JuZ9umeGa4